11/18/2022 - 2022 Baseball Factory Fall Prospects Tournament (HS) Raley is a 2025 LHP/OF who showcased his skills during the Fall Prospects Tournament. In the OF, he showed good range and has good instincts. He worked to center the baseball and works with good direction through the baseball. He has a clean funnel off of his right foot. He throws from a 3/4 arm slot into the infield with a quick release. At the plate, he hits from an athletic and even stance. He starts with a short glide step and stays balanced throughout swing. Good rotation enables him to hit line drives to all fields with a with a bat exit velocity up to 77mph during BP. During the games, he had 2 singles, and 2 RBI's. A left-handed pitcher, he starts with a small rocker step and strides in-line to his target. He attacks hitters with a FB that topped out at 72mph. We look forward to seeing what the future holds for Raley as he enters his sophomore baseball season.

01/14/2022 - 2022 Baseball Factory Pre-Season Prospects Tournament (HS) Raley is an OF/LHP who will graduate in 2025. Medium frame lean build with strength present and plenty of room to develop. In the OF, good reads off bat and efficient footwork enables him to take good routes to balls. Square fielding position as he fields ball out front with ability to make routine plays. Throws from a over the top arm slot with an arm velocity of 67mph into infield. On the mound, this left-handed pitcher works with good tempo. Good direction towards plate and ability to throw strikes. Attacks hitters with a FB that was up to 67mph, a breaking ball 2/8 shape, and a changeup he throws with FB arm speed. In 2 innings of work, Raley induced weak contact and a strikeout looking. A left-handed hitter, starts with an athletic and closed stance. Quiet head/eyes enable him to track pitches well. Showed good awareness of the strike zone. Simple and balanced swing with ability to hit balls to all fields with a recorded bat exit velocity of 74mph. As he continues to develop and mature, we see him having a bright future on the baseball field.

09/24/2021 - MS All-Region Tournament Raley is a 2025 OF/LHP prospect who showcased his skills during the All Region Tournament. In the outfield, he showed good agility, with active feet, and ability to make routine plays. He gains ground downhill to baseball. He throws from a 3/4 arm slot, with a long arm action in back, and an arm velocity into cutoff man up to 72mph. On the mound, Raley gets a good rear hip coil and works with good direction down the mound. A clean arm action with good extension to mitt and he pitches to contact. He attacks hitters with a FB that sat 64-66mph with some movement in the strike zone. In 3 innings of work, he stuck out 2 hitters and induced soft contact. At the plate, he sets up in an even and upright stance. Stays tall throughout swing and has an athletic finish. Sprayed balls to all fields with a bat exit velocity 68mph. Had 5 singles and a base on balls in live game action. With four more years to develop, Raley has the time and potential to further build upon his skills on the field.

Tool Grade Scale

Our main goals with the BF "10-70" Scouting Scale are to provide the player with a realistic evaluation of his "PRESENT" abilities (what he can do today), and to provide college coaches with information they can use to identify and/or compare potential recruits.

Tools are graded for all players and pitchers, regardless of age or graduation year. However, for High School players we use only grades 20-70 (grades 10-18 do not apply), while for Middle School players we use only grades 10-52 (grades 55-70 do not apply).
